Secret Celebration at Windsor Castle

On October 29, 2025, King Charles III hosted a private party at Windsor Castle to celebrate the 90th birthday of Prince Edward, Duke of Kent. The event, which took place in the evening, was attended by several senior royals, including Princess Anne, Vice Admiral Sir Timothy Laurence, Prince Richard, Duke of Gloucester, and the Duke of Kent's siblings, Prince Michael and Princess Alexandra. Notably absent were Prince William and Kate Middleton, who were on a family break with their children during the school holiday.

Background on the Duke of Kent

Prince Edward, Duke of Kent, is a first cousin to both the late Queen Elizabeth II and King Charles III. He has served as a working royal since retiring from the British Army in 1976. His wife, Katharine, Duchess of Kent, passed away on September 4, 2025, shortly before this celebration, which added a layer of significance to the gathering.

Royal Family Dynamics

The celebration comes at a time of heightened scrutiny and tension within the royal family, particularly surrounding Prince Andrew and his recent decision to relinquish his Duke of York title amid ongoing scandals. Reports indicate that Prince William and Kate Middleton have taken a more assertive role in managing royal affairs, particularly concerning Andrew's controversies. Sources suggest that William has been advocating for a stricter approach to Andrew's involvement in royal life, aiming to protect the monarchy's reputation.

Official Statements & Responses

King Charles's office acknowledged the Duke of Kent's milestone birthday with a festive message on social media, expressing well-wishes and confirming the party's arrangements. The royal family has shown solidarity in supporting King Charles's decisions regarding Andrew, with insiders noting that William and Kate are aligned in their approach to distancing the family from Andrew's scandals.
